Gray Media, Inc. is a multimedia company head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, and is the largest owner of top-rated local television stations and digital assets in the United States. Founded in 1897, the company evolved from Gray Communications Systems through strategic acquisitions and transformations aligned with the changing media landscape. Gray owns and operates television stations in 113 markets across the United States, serving communities ranging from major metropolitan areas like Atlanta to smaller markets. The company is the largest group owner and operator of NBC-affiliated stations and the second-largest group owner of ABC affiliates, as well as operating the largest Telemundo Affiliate group. Gray's portfolio includes markets with top-rated and first or second highest-rated television stations. The company also owns Gray Digital Media, a full-service digital agency offering national and local clients digital marketing strategies with advanced digital products and services. Additional media properties include video production companies Raycom Sports, Tupelo Media Group, and PowerNation Studios, studio production facilities Assembly Atlanta and Third Rail Studios, and a majority interest in Swirl Films. Gray completed transformative acquisitions including Raycom Media in 2019, followed by Quincy Media and Meredith Corporation's Local Media Group. The company formally changed its name from Gray Television, Inc. to Gray Media, Inc. effective January 2025 to reflect its diversified reach beyond traditional broadcasting and ongoing investments in new business models and technologies. Gray Media is publicly traded on the New York Stock Exchange under the symbols GTN and GTN.A.

Founded in 2001 and headquartered in Ontario, Canada, Bell Media is a Canadian media conglomerate that is the mass media subsidiary of BCE Inc. Its operations include television broadcasting and production, radio broadcasting, digital media and Internet properties.
